This YouTube video from Fun Gun Reviews showcases the PPS43C Pistol, manufactured in Radom, Poland. The review highlights the firearm's historical significance as a design originating from Russia during WWII, noting its continued service globally in its full-auto carbine variant. The presenter emphasizes the quality, reliability, and effectiveness of the 7.62x25 Tokarev caliber. The video offers a glimpse into a piece of firearm history.
